Jak uzyskać pojedynczą ścieżkę SVG

Opublikowany: 2023-01-01

Jeśli chcesz uzyskać plik SVG z pojedynczą ścieżką , musisz wykonać kilka czynności. Najpierw musisz znaleźć konwerter online, który może zamienić Twój obraz w plik SVG. Po znalezieniu konwertera po prostu prześlij obraz i pozwól konwerterowi wykonać swoją pracę. Następnie musisz otworzyć plik SVG w programie do edycji wektorów, takim jak Adobe Illustrator. Po otwarciu pliku zaznacz wszystkie obiekty na obrazie, a następnie kliknij menu „Ścieżka”. Stamtąd będziesz chciał wybrać opcję „Uprość”. Zmniejszy to liczbę punktów kontrolnych na obrazie i ułatwi pracę. Na koniec będziesz chciał zapisać plik jako EPS lub PDF. Dzięki temu obraz zachowa swoją jakość podczas drukowania lub wyświetlania go na ekranie. I to wszystko! Wystarczy kilka prostych kroków, aby łatwo uzyskać pojedynczą ścieżkę SVG.

Jak wyeksportować Svg do pojedynczej ścieżki?

Jak wyeksportować Svg do pojedynczej ścieżki?
Obraz autorstwa – imgur

Nie ma jednego ostatecznego sposobu na wyeksportowanie pliku SVG do jednej ścieżki. Niektóre metody obejmują użycie edytora grafiki wektorowej, takiego jak Adobe Illustrator lub Inkscape, lub użycie narzędzia konwertującego, takiego jak Autodesk Graphic.

Jak scalić ścieżki Svg?

Union można znaleźć w menu Ścieżka. Zaleca się zapisanie pliku. Czym są pliki aresvg i czy są darmowe?

Czy można narysować dowolną ścieżkę w Svg?

Ścieżka jest zawsze używana niezależnie od innych elementów rysunkowych pod maską. Element ścieżki ma tylko jeden atrybut: atrybut d. Pathtag jest wykonany z metalu, a nie z tworzywa sztucznego.


Co to jest znacznik ścieżki w formacie Svg?

Co to jest znacznik ścieżki w formacie Svg?
Obraz autorstwa – imgur

Znacznik ścieżki służy do tworzenia elementu ścieżki w pliku SVG. Ten element służy do tworzenia grafiki, której można użyć do przedstawienia zestawu danych lub do stworzenia atrakcyjnej wizualnie grafiki.

Pathtags: Metalowa alternatywa dla plastiku

Każdy pathtag ma swój własny projekt.
Celem pathtagu nie jest gromadzenie ani handel.
SVG.path składa się z różnych obiektów, które implementują różne polecenia ścieżki.

Ścieżka Svg

Ścieżka svg to element, który pozwala narysować linię między dwoma punktami. Jest często używany do tworzenia linii na mapie lub łączenia dwóch punktów na wykresie.

Istnieją cztery obiekty segmentu ścieżki : linia, łuk, sześcienny i kwadratowy bezier. Ponadto istnieje klasa Path, która jest instancjonowana i zawiera sekwencję segmentów ścieżki. Długość ścieżki lub segmentu można obliczyć za pomocą funkcji length(). Istnieje ogólna zgoda co do tego, że przybliżenie geometryczne jest najskuteczniejszą metodą, ale niektóre klasy mogą być powolne. Ścieżki to zmienne sekwencje, które można wycinać i wklejać. Nie jesteś chroniony, jeśli utworzysz nieprawidłowe ścieżki. Jeśli każdy segment ścieżki ma zostać odwrócony, musi być rozsądnie cofnięty.

Metody manipulacji ścieżkami również mogą ulec zmianie w przyszłości, dlatego muszą być spójne. Python w wersji 5.0.1 został wydany 23 marca 2017 r. Polecenia pionowe i poziome zostały ulepszone. Proces generowania tekstów ścieżek SVG został zrefaktoryzowany, umożliwiając każdemu segmentowi generowanie własnego tekstu segmentu. Nowe minimalne wymagania Pythona to teraz 3.7. Python 2, podobnie jak Python 3, powinien zostać usunięty z listy. Aby zaimportować dane ABC do Pythona, użyj collections.abc dla importu ABC, który jest zgodny z Pythonem w wersji 39.3.

Jest teraz wsparcie dla Pythona 3.7 i 3.8, ale nie dla Jythona. Ścieżki podrzędne nie są już łączone, nawet jeśli są połączone, a polecenia przenoszenia są nadal analizowane. Do obliczeń segmentów cylindrycznych i łukowych dodano powtarzalność, a każdy z nich ma własny zestaw parametrów dokładności. Jakie są rodzaje ścieżek svg?

Różne typy ścieżek Svg

W sva istnieją dwa rodzaje ścieżek: ścieżki bezwzględne i ścieżki względne. Ścieżka bezwzględna zaczyna się i kończy w punkcie i porusza się w określonym kierunku podczas renderowania dokumentu, podczas gdy ścieżka względna zaczyna się i kończy w punkcie i porusza się w określonym kierunku podczas renderowania dokumentu. Najprostsza ścieżka, ścieżka bezwzględna, to taka, której będziesz najczęściej używać. Ścieżka jest reprezentowana przez ścieżkę względną, która przemieszcza się z jednego punktu do drugiego w miarę renderowania dokumentu. Jeśli chcesz umieścić elementy względem siebie, zamiast zaczynać od tych samych współrzędnych, przydatna jest ścieżka względna. Ścieżki względne mogą mieć charakter lokalny lub globalny. Lokalna ścieżka względna jest definiowana w punkcie, w którym znajduje się bieżący element, podczas gdy globalna ścieżka względna jest definiowana w punkcie początkowym dokumentu (0,0). Oprócz ścieżki, Beziera i kwadratowej ścieżki absolutnej istnieje kilka przykładów. Ścieżka to bardzo prosta ścieżka, która jest najczęściej używanym typem ścieżki bezwzględnej. Ścieżka Beziera jest rodzajem ścieżki względnej z serią krzywych, która umożliwia utworzenie złożonej ścieżki . Ścieżka kwadratowa jest zasadniczo rodzajem ścieżki bezwzględnej, w której szereg linii prostych jest używany do generowania złożonej ścieżki. W SVG Path Editor możesz zmienić i zoptymalizować element ścieżki.

Konwertuj Svg na pojedynczą ścieżkę online

Istnieje wiele sposobów konwersji pliku svg na pojedynczą ścieżkę. Jednym ze sposobów jest użycie konwertera online, który można znaleźć za pomocą prostej wyszukiwarki Google. Ta metoda jest szybka i łatwa i nie wymaga żadnego specjalnego oprogramowania ani umiejętności. Innym sposobem jest użycie programu do edycji wektorów, takiego jak Adobe Illustrator. Ta metoda może być bardziej czasochłonna, ale daje użytkownikowi większą kontrolę nad produktem końcowym.

można edytować rzutnie, skalę, odwracanie, obracanie i segmenty ścieżki. Za pomocą przycisku analizy możesz wyszukiwać i usuwać segmenty, które nie pasują. Zobacz sekcję Break Apart, aby zapoznać się z opcjami eksportu. Dostępne są cztery różne tryby działania. ( 2) Nie pokazano żadnych segmentów. Jeśli wybierzesz tryb domyślny, zostaną wyświetlone te segmenty i ich współrzędne krzywej. W kolejnych segmentach pokazane są tylko segmenty M, oprócz indeksu segmentów (3).

Indeks tych segmentów (małe prostokąty) jest wyświetlany pod współrzędnymi każdego segmentu. Współrzędne pokazane na segmentach M podano w nawiasach, z jednym pokazanym jako komentarz. Shift N może być użyty do włączenia lub wyłączenia numeru linii w obszarze tekstowym. Mój system identyfikuje pliki SVG na podstawie ich warstw i nazw obiektów.

Illustrator Eksport Svg Pojedyncza ścieżka

Nie ma jednej ostatecznej odpowiedzi na to pytanie, ponieważ najlepszy sposób wyeksportowania pliku SVG z projektu programu Illustrator będzie się różnić w zależności od konkretnego projektu i pożądanego wyniku. Jednak jedną z ogólnych metod eksportowania pliku SVG z pojedynczą ścieżką jest utworzenie ścieżki w programie Illustrator, a następnie użycie elementu menu „Obiekt > Ścieżka > Obrys konturu” w celu przekształcenia obrysu w wypełnienie. Następnie użyj pozycji menu „Obiekt > Rozwiń”, aby rozszerzyć ścieżkę do bryły. Na koniec użyj pozycji menu „Plik > Zapisz jako”, aby zapisać plik w formacie SVG .

W rezultacie, gdy używam narzędzia Pióro do utworzenia pojedynczego punktu przy użyciu wartości x,y, są one używane do reprezentowania danych współrzędnych. Ścieżka z dwoma lub więcej punktami zostanie utworzona oprócz ścieżek z dwoma lub więcej punktami. Kiedy eksportuję te obiekty za pomocą eksportera zasobów, jedna ścieżka nie jest eksportowana, a dwie lub więcej tak. Do mojej pracy chciałbym, żeby była w prostszym wariancie SVG. Ścieżka obiektu to geometria jego konturu, która obejmuje ruch do, linię do, krzywą do (zarówno sześcienną, jak i kwadratową), łuki i bliskie ścieżki.

Generator ścieżki krzywej SVG

Generator ścieżki krzywej SVG to narzędzie, którego można użyć do stworzenia zakrzywionej ścieżki dla obrazu SVG . Można to wykorzystać do stworzenia bardziej złożonego obrazu lub po prostu dodać trochę zainteresowania do istniejącego obrazu. Istnieje wiele różnych narzędzi, których można użyć do stworzenia generatora ścieżki krzywej svg, ale najpopularniejszym jest prawdopodobnie Adobe Illustrator.

Wiele ścieżek podrzędnych w ścieżce złożonej może służyć do generowania otworów pierścieniowych w obiektach i może służyć do generowania ścieżek złożonych. Rozdział 2, sekcja 2, dotyczy składni, zachowania i interfejsów DOM ścieżek SVG. Dane ścieżki to zbiór poleceń, które kończą się pojedynczym znakiem. Składnia danych ścieżek jest zwięzła i pozwala na wydajne pobieranie, ponieważ nie ma potrzeby stosowania dużych rozmiarów plików. Ilość znaków nowego wiersza w pliku danych ścieżki można podzielić na wiele wierszy, aby ułatwić czytanie. Kiedy spacje są analizowane jako atrybuty w znacznikach, znaki nowej linii w tych atrybutach zostaną znormalizowane do zawartych w nich spacji. Ciąg danych ścieżki zawiera wartość określającą kształt pola.

Błędy w łańcuchu są obsługiwane zgodnie z sekcją Obsługa błędów danych ścieżki danych ścieżki. Aby rozpocząć segment danych ścieżki (jeśli taki istnieje), należy wykonać polecenie moveto. Wyróżnia się automatyczną linią prostą poprowadzoną od bieżącego punktu do punktu początkowego bieżącej podścieżki. Ten segment ścieżki nie może mieć więcej niż kilka tysięcy znaków. Ścieżki bliskie używają wartości „stroke-linejoin”, aby połączyć koniec ostatniego segmentu ścieżki podrzędnej z początkiem pierwszego segmentu. Zamknięta ścieżka podrzędna zachowuje się inaczej niż otwarta ścieżka podrzędna, ponieważ pierwsza i ostatnia ścieżka nie przecinają się. Operacje zamkniętej ścieżki nie są obecnie obsługiwane przez Pythona w zakresie przetwarzania segmentów.

Sekwencja poleceń biegnie po linii prostej od bieżącego punktu do nowego punktu: Gdy używane jest polecenie względne l, linia kończy się na (cpx x, cpy x). Dodatnia wartość x w względnym poleceniu h powoduje pojawienie się linii poziomej w kierunku dodatniej osi x. Poniższe pięć przykładów ilustruje istnienie segmentu ścieżki sześciennej w przypadku segmentu ścieżki Beziera. Oto niektóre polecenia dotyczące łuków eliptycznych, które powinieneś znać. Gdy używane jest polecenie względne, punktem końcowym łuku jest (cPY x, cPY y). Flaga dużego łuku i flaga przeciągnięcia wskazują, czy narysowano linię z czterema łukami. W przypadku EBNF przetwarzanie musi zająć jak najwięcej danej produkcji, aby postać nie spełniała całkowicie wymagań produkcyjnych.

Renderowanie jest wyłączone, gdy wartość właściwości d wynosi zero. Podczas obliczania kształtu zakończenia i znaczników renderowania domyślny kierunek na granicach segmentu nie jest zastępowany. Jeśli wartości rx lub ry wynoszą zero, łuk jest traktowany jako odcinek linii prostej (lineto). Ta operacja skalowania jest wykonywana przy użyciu wzoru matematycznego w dodatku do operacji skalowania. Segmenty ścieżki bez długości nie są nieprawidłowe, a renderowanie zostanie zakłócone w następujących przypadkach: Aby skalować obliczenia odległości wzdłuż ścieżki, autor może użyć atrybutu „pathLength”, który oblicza całkowitą długość ścieżki. Operacja „moveto” w elemencie ścieżki nie ma czasu trwania. Długości ścieżek są obliczane przy użyciu różnych poleceń lineto, curveto i arcto. Element path definiuje ścieżkę.

Ścieżki, łuki i gradienty liniowe

Wszystkie podstawowe kształty są opisane w kategoriach ich równoważnej ścieżki , czyli jakie są ich kształty. Ścieżka elementu jest taka sama, jak ścieżka elementu „ścieżka”. Łuki można tworzyć za pomocą polecenia „łuk”. Okrąg to okrąg lub elipsa, podczas gdy oś to wycinek obiektu. Na okręgach o promieniach x i y można połączyć dowolne dwa punkty (o ile leżą w promieniu okręgu). Dwie elipsy najlepiej pasują do danych kształtów o promieniach x i y (o ile mieszczą się w promieniu koła). Gradient liniowy można utworzyć za pomocą polecenia „linearGradient”. Sposób, w jaki światło oddziałuje z kolorem, tworząc widmo, podobnie jak sposób, w jaki światło oddziałuje z kolorem, tworząc widmo, jest tym, co tworzy kolor gradientu. Punkty zatrzymania można wygenerować za pomocą polecenia „stop”. Punkt zatrzymania, jak sama nazwa wskazuje, to po prostu punkt na ziemi, w którym kończy się nachylenie.